Is it safe to have sex during pregnancy? Many couples have this question in mind. They just don’t want to risk the baby in any way. In most of the cases, it is absolutely safe to have sex during pregnancy. However, if you have any complication during your pregnancy and your doctor has advised to have complete bed rest or other sort of precautions, they will inform you or you should feel free to ask this question to them. In such cases, you might be advised to avoid having a relationship during your pregnancy to avoid any further complications. Will sex during pregnancy harm the baby? In normal pregnancies it does not harm your baby in any way. Your baby is in your placenta which is much inside your body and protects your baby in many ways. Sex during pregnancy will not harm the baby. The protective covering of the baby – the amniotic fluid and strong muscles – will keep the baby safe. Will Sex Trigger Labor? Iron is an essential nutrition during pregnancy. Iron deficiency anemia occurs when your red blood cell is less than the required count. During pregnancy, iron helps create haemoglobin for you and your baby. Lack of haemoglobin can cause tiredness, breathlessness and can have severe complications like preterm delivery, infant mortality, or low birth weight. How much Iron is needed during pregnancy? A normal person needs 18 mg of iron every day. During pregnancy, this intake should be around 27 mg every day. What are the causes of low iron? Lack of Iron in your diet: If your diet does not contain enough of iron, you might get iron deficiency. If you are a vegetarian, ensure you also get proper vitamin C in your diet so that your body absorbs the iron you take. Loss of blood: If you have any previous surgery experience where you had lost a lot of blood, you can be the case of iron deficiency. Women with high blood loss during periods can also get iron deficiency. Constipation is a common problem during pregnancy. Almost half of the women pregnant complained of the same. The reason behind this is the ongoing hormonal changes in your body. These hormones make your muscles relaxed leading to even relaxation of muscles in your digestive tracts which keeps the food to hang around longer. Treatment of Constipation during pregnancy Pregnancy is a time when you need to avoid medicines as much as possible. In case of constipation, few lifestyle changes can help you get some relief: 1- Improve your diet: Include fiber-rich foods like whole-grain cereal, whole wheat bread, pulses, brown rice, fruits, and vegetables. A regular fiber-rich diet will add a difference to your digestion in the long run. 2- Drink plenty of water: Drink plenty of water throughout the day. Try drinking warm water if the constipation is too much. 3- Avoid Iron Supplements: Constipation can also occur due to iron supplements you take during pregnancy. If the iron is too high in the supplement you are taking, consult your doctor and change your supplement. 4- Exercise regularly.
